Transaction cd7b223efea7c12a1d21f4ed7e28709f3c97150daf21c76cdfef0f3f7d285867
1 Input
2 Outputs
- cd7b223efea7c12a1d21f4ed7e28709f3c97150daf21c76cdfef0f3f7d285867:0
- cd7b223efea7c12a1d21f4ed7e28709f3c97150daf21c76cdfef0f3f7d285867:1
value 86712
address 3MtBufW1tjwaZA7cP4TgPEgECkucQTUMRL
value 18214300
address 1Gg3b9Q5Cs9vrf5u79AQSxFDdopo5pgGwu